اذهب الي المحتوي
أوفيسنا

ما هو الخطأ فى هذه الدالة


safwatscc

الردود الموصى بها

مربع نص فى تذليل صفحة التقرير يقوم بعد كل ما هو حالتة باق فى البيانات التى تظهر فقط فى التقرير

                 =Count(IIf([hala] = [باق];0))                  

العمود اسمة Hala ويوجد به قيمتان اما باق او مستجد

مطلوب تعديل الكود لكى يعد باق

وشكرا

post-31538-0-97343700-1311253139_thumb.j

تم تعديل بواسطه safwatscc
رابط هذا التعليق
شارك

السلام عليكم

أنا كنت طلبت تفسيرا لدالة iif

بهذا الشكر

أين الإجراء فى حالة تحقق الشرط

و أين الإجراء فى حالة عدم تحقق الشرط

أرجو التفسير أستاذ شهرانى

أفادكم الله

رابط هذا التعليق
شارك

السلام عليكم

أنا كنت طلبت تفسيرا لدالة iif

بهذا الشكر

أين الإجراء فى حالة تحقق الشرط

و أين الإجراء فى حالة عدم تحقق الشرط

أرجو التفسير أستاذ شهرانى

أفادكم الله

وعليكم السلام ورحمه الله وبركاته

اخوي

داله iif الشرطيه تحتوي على ثلاثه اجزاء

الجزء الاول التعبير الشرطي

الجزء الثاني النتيجه اذا تحقق الشرط التعبيري في الجزء الاول

الجزء الثالث النتيجه اذا لم يتحقق الشرط التعبيري في الجزء اول

وهذه تركيبه iif

IIf(expr, truepart, falsepart)

في مثال العضو السائل

اذا كان السجل = "مستجد", اذا صفرO ، اذا لم يتحقق لاشي

طبعا الصفر يعتبر عدد وسوف تقوم داله count بعده

طبعا يمكنك استبدال الصفر باي قيمه تريد

ان شاء الله اتضحت الفكره

رابط هذا التعليق
شارك

شكرا لك

فهمت الآتى

أننا حذفنا الجزء الثالث من الدالة و هو يفهم تلقائيا

دالة count تعد الصفر

باعتبار أن الصفر غير الفراغ

يعنى تعد الأصفار

رابط هذا التعليق
شارك

بالضبط

الجزء الثالث لايهمنا هنا و انما الجزء الثاني هو المهم لان المطلوب من داله count هو عد كم مره تحقق الشرط و لانريد وضع الشرط الثالث حتى لا يتم عده اذا اصبح رقم ولاكنها لاتعد الفراغ لذلك اهمل

رابط هذا التعليق
شارك

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information